From 4ba53742159e166fd25cc5c83a953bc1e39c81d9 Mon Sep 17 00:00:00 2001 From: Mason Larobina Date: Sat, 5 Dec 2009 17:12:59 +0800 Subject: Added @jsh JavaScript helper variable. --- examples/config/uzbl/config |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'examples') diff --git a/examples/config/uzbl/config b/examples/config/uzbl/config index a9ae29a..54de972 100644 --- a/examples/config/uzbl/config +++ b/examples/config/uzbl/config @@ -29,6 +29,8 @@ set shell_cmd = sh -c # Spawn path shortcuts. In spawn the first dir+path match is used in "dir1:dir2:dir3:executable" set scripts_dir = $XDG_DATA_HOME/uzbl:@prefix/share/uzbl/examples/data/uzbl:scripts +# Javascipt helpers. +set jsh = js var run=Uzbl.run; function get(k){return run("print \\\@"+k)}; function set(k, v) {run("set "+k+" = "+v)}; # === Handlers =============================================================== @@ -141,7 +143,6 @@ set open_new_window = sh 'uzbl-browser -u \@SELECTED_URI' @bind = js if("\@SELECTED_URI") { Uzbl.run("\@open_new_window"); } else { Uzbl.run("\\\@load_from_xclip"); } # Edit HTML forms in external editor -# set external_editor = gvim #set external_editor = xterm -e vim @bind E = script @scripts_dir/extedit.js -- cgit v1.2.3